Senior Finanical Planning Operations Associate
Location : New York, New York City
Refer job # UJTK338943
 
Job Responsibilities and Requirements: This will include: - Planning agreements received are in compliance with the Eagle Strategies rules governing the agreements. - Plans are complete per the agreement and within the allotted time frames. - Review submitted plans for accuracy and completeness. - Advisors are compensated timely and accurately for the planning they have done. - Process and record all customer complaints regarding the plan and - Process refunds if required. Advisor Interaction: Communication and Advisor Support: - Timely responses to Advisors around the business submission process. - Clear and distinct written and verbal communications to Advisors around challenges and issue that may have come up with their work product. - Problem resolution surrounding communicated issues. - Training of Advisors and their staff on the planning process. Planning Process Improvements: - As technology improves the need to refine and implement new technologies is critical to improve efficiencies. This position will require thought and execution around process improvement. Audit and Quality: - The business Eagle Strategies engages in is highly regulated. As such, Eagle is audited by a number of Organization, both inside and outside of New York Life. The position will have responsibility around ensuring all process work is done in compliance with regulatory and company rules. The position is also responsible for gathering and supplying all information requested during our various review. Business Continuity Liaison: - FPO will manage and catalogue all records related to third-party pay for service contracts, business resiliency and continuity responsibilities and contingency plans for the Financial Planning and Commissions areas. - Ad Hoc Requests from WM Leadership and Backup for Critical Planning Functions. Qualifications: - Bachelor's Degree or higher - CFP Designation highly recommended for applicants - Minimum 5-10 years of relevant experience; experience working with insurance agents in a career agency business unit is essential - Excellent PC skills in MS Word, Excel, PowerPoint, Lotus Notes, MS Project a plus Excellent written and verbal communication skills - Strong interpersonal skills and the ability to exercise informal influence - Ability to handle multiple priorities simultaneously - High level of professionalism - Professional writing skills - Understanding of operational principals around accuracy, efficiency and speed - Prior exposure to the process associated with creating and publishing various types of operational documents and collateral - including process flows, fact cards and training materials EOE M/F/D/V.
